Individual Test Categories + +```bash +# Run specific test types +make test-basic-cors # Basic CORS configuration +make test-preflight-cors # Preflight OPTIONS requests +make test-actual-cors # Actual CORS request handling +make test-origin-matching # Origin matching logic +make test-header-matching # Header matching logic +make test-method-matching # Method matching logic +make test-multiple-rules # Multiple CORS rules +make test-validation # CORS validation +make test-caching # CORS caching behavior +make test-error-handling # Error handling +``` + +## Test Server Management + +The tests use a comprehensive server management system similar to other SeaweedFS integration tests: + +### Server Configuration + +- **S3 Port**: 8333 (configurable via `S3_PORT`) +- **Master Port**: 9333 +- **Volume Port**: 8080 +- **Filer Port**: 8888 +- **Metrics Port**: 9324 +- **Data Directory**: `./test-volume-data` (auto-created) +- **Log File**: `weed-test.log` + +### Server Lifecycle + +1. **Build**: Automatically builds `../../../weed/weed_binary` +2. **Start**: Launches SeaweedFS with S3 API enabled +3. **Health Check**: Waits up to 90 seconds for server to be ready +4. **Test**: Runs the requested tests +5. **Stop**: Gracefully shuts down the server +6. **Cleanup**: Removes temporary files and data + +### Available Commands + +```bash +# Server management +make start-server # Start SeaweedFS server +make stop-server # Stop SeaweedFS server +make health-check # Check server health +make logs # View server logs + +# Test execution +make test-with-server # Full test cycle with server management +make test-cors-simple # Run tests without server management +make test-cors-quick # Run core tests only +make test-cors-comprehensive # Run all tests + +# Development +make dev-start # Start server for development +make dev-test # Run development tests +make build-weed # Build SeaweedFS binary +make check-deps # Check dependencies + +# Maintenance +make clean # Clean up all artifacts +make coverage # Generate coverage report +make fmt # Format code +make lint # Run linter +``` + +## Test Configuration + +### Default Configuration + +The tests use these default settings (configurable via environment variables): + +```bash +WEED_BINARY=../../../weed/weed_binary +S3_PORT=8333 +TEST_TIMEOUT=10m +TEST_PATTERN=TestCORS +``` + +### Configuration File + +The `test_config.json` file contains S3 client configuration: + +```json +{ + "endpoint": "http://localhost:8333", + "access_key": "some_access_key1", + "secret_key": "some_secret_key1", + "region": "us-east-1", + "bucket_prefix": "test-cors-", + "use_ssl": false, + "skip_verify_ssl": true +} +``` + +## Troubleshooting + +### Compilation Issues + +If you encounter compilation errors, the most common issues are: + +1. **AWS SDK v2 Type Mismatches**: The `MaxAgeSeconds` field in `types.CORSRule` expects `int32`, not `*int32`. Use direct values like `3600` instead of `aws.Int32(3600)`. + +2. **Field Name Issues**: The `GetBucketCorsOutput` type has a `CORSRules` field directly, not a `CORSConfiguration` field. + +Example fix: +```go +// ❌ Incorrect +MaxAgeSeconds: aws.Int32(3600), +assert.Len(t, getResp.CORSConfiguration.CORSRules, 1) + +// ✅ Correct +MaxAgeSeconds: 3600, +assert.Len(t, getResp.CORSRules, 1) +``` + +### Server Issues + +1. **Server Won't Start** + ```bash + # Check for port conflicts + netstat -tlnp | grep 8333 + + # View server logs + make logs + + # Force cleanup + make clean + ``` + +2. **Test Failures** + ```bash + # Run with server management + make test-with-server + + # Run specific test + make test-basic-cors + + # Check server health + make health-check + ``` + +3. **Connection Issues** + ```bash + # Verify server is running + curl -s http://localhost:8333 + + # Check server logs + tail -f weed-test.log + ``` + +### Performance Issues + +If tests are slow or timing out: + +```bash +# Increase timeout +export TEST_TIMEOUT=30m +make test-with-server + +# Run quick tests only +make test-cors-quick + +# Check server resources +make debug-status +``` + +## Test Coverage + +### Core Functionality Tests + +#### 1.
